I keep looking on the bay for a socket 478 processor.

I've missed out on a 3.4 EE which went for £70.
I've bought a 3.2C northwood (£47) but its gone missing in the post.

What should I be looking for, and what should I be paying.

With that motherboard either a Northwood or Prescott cpu would be fine, but the N/Wood will run cooler, as already stated look for a 800 (with Hyperthreading Technology) version (try and find one > 3.0GHz), I would think it will be hard to find another EE CPU, as these are quite rare.

I used the P4P800 E Deluxe with a 3.4GHz N/wood, and a 3.2GHz Prescott. :)

Yup, look for 2.4C, 2.6C 2.8C P4s, they are cheap and all overclock really well.

No point spending more than £30ish.
